KATHMANDU, April 24: Sunrise Bank Ltd has opened a new branch office at Buddha Shanti VDC of Jhapa.
According to the bank, the new branch was jointly inaugurated by Rabin Nepal, deputy general manager of the bank, amid a function on Sunday. “The new branch has been established to provide easy banking services to customers in and around Buddha Shanti VDC.
The new branch will also provide ‘Safe Deposit Locker’ facility to its customers,” the bank said in a statement. Sunrise Bank Ltd has been providing banking services through 69 branch offices, 78 ATM outlets and 13 branchless banking units.
The bank plans to open new branch offices in Ghattekulo of Kathmandu, Birendranagar of Surkhet and Hetaunda of Makawanpur in the new future.
